Transaction 2c31b57ddf1dadf393e151d4eb72ba267b0c564f30ee33b85cb4df830f547f53

11 Input
2 Outputs
  • 2c31b57ddf1dadf393e151d4eb72ba267b0c564f30ee33b85cb4df830f547f53:0
  • value  699866780
    address  3KV3LzwYBkynQ1ptYDSsMBhJSoYRd3Fgjb
  • 2c31b57ddf1dadf393e151d4eb72ba267b0c564f30ee33b85cb4df830f547f53:1
  • value  195951452
    address  3C2MufJdpyY2G8brETdAA9s3tuZEbvCmEV